Ingredients

  • 8 large ripe pears , peeled, cut into 1 inch cubes (about 8 cups)
  • 2 tablespoons pure maple syrup
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1 teaspoon ground ginger
  • 1/4 cup water

Instructions

Put the pears, maple syrup, cinnamon, ginger, and water into a medium pot, stir well, and set over high heat. When the liquid comes to a boil, drop the heat to low, cover the pot with a lid, and simmer.

Cook the pears, stirring occasionally, until they are tender enough to mash with a fork, about 20 minutes. Be sure that a little liquid remains in the bottom of the pot at all times. If not, add a tablespoon or 2 as needed. If quite a bit of juice remains when the pears are nearly cooked, remove the lid and turn up the heat so excess liquid evaporates.

Transfer the pears to a blender or food processor and puree until silky smooth. Serve warm or store in a container and refrigerate. The sauce will firm up as it cools.
